Boeing Aircraft Parts Full Life Cycle Management

2021-01-26

Since 2010, Quanray chips QSTAR-35 (2Kbits) and QSTAR-2A (64Kbits) have been continuously used in aviation parts management of aircraft manufacturers such as Boeing and Airbus. Quanray Electronics was the only domestic chip supplier that could meet THE ATA Spec 2000 CH-9.5 specification and provide chip products for Boeing and Airbus. In the past ten years, Quanray Electronics has been continuously developing and iterating chips suitable for aviation parts management, which have been updated to QSTAR-56 (2Kbits) and QSTAR-5A (64Kbits) chips. Through years of cooperation, Quanray Electronics has established strategic partnerships with major RFID tag suppliers from Boeing and Airbus to provide them with a series of standardized and customized technical services.

Flight attendants sort traditional airline parts. Before using RFID to manage life jackets, flight attendants need to check them one by one for at least 6.5 hours and ensure that all life jackets are ready under the seats. Long-term bowing and bending actions of flight attendants are easy to cause occupational disease hazards to health. A high-reliability RFID tag is attached to each life jacket, enabling flight attendants to determine the status of all life jackets in only 8 minutes. Besides, the label can effectively monitor the life of the life jacket, significantly improving the life jacket in the life cycle to maximize rational use.

After using RFID technology to manage life jackets, Airbus and Boeing's intelligent management effect promotes the use of RFID tags in more aviation parts management, such as oxygen cylinders, oxygen generators, fire hydrants, seats and even some sophisticated equipment that need maintenance. Their advantages become more prominent. In 2012, Quanray Electronics participated in the Airbus supply chain optimization project and had shipped more than 20 million chips for Airbus so far (data in June 2019).
